Output 59634952c1253b2e498882a121806b20633c86180d5a5f25090117944b19809d:0

value
2447587
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 49a3d7e43442bf551aecc1453281ffd5525368fa OP_EQUALVERIFY OP_CHECKSIG
address
17iNc3B5KFEXiYq3EkG74pizBwmXx4VUR6
transaction
59634952c1253b2e498882a121806b20633c86180d5a5f25090117944b19809d
spent
true